    Belafonte/MFD/STH 14 Driver touring setup for sale/trade

    182 Moment Belafonte (green/white/black version). Rockered tip. Bought the skis from Skiwald here on TGR. 2 mounts, not sure what BSL.

    S/M MFD Alltime plates with brand new STH 14 Driver binding (1 day of use, but I'll be touring on them at the local hill until they sell). Mounted boot-center on the recommended line.

    Tried this ski & it wasn't my kind of ski. This ski is stiffer and longer than I want. I'm more of a playful skier, than a charger.
    Selling entire package for $550 + ship. Don't really want to split.
    Also willing to consider a trade +/-$ for a touring setup with a softer and/or shorter ski. I'd like something with at least a rockered tip, if I trade.
